public class QDR.QDRMapEntry
extends java.lang.Object
implements java.util.Map.Entry
| Modifier and Type | Field and Description |
|---|---|
protected java.lang.String |
m_key |
protected java.lang.Object |
m_value |
| Constructor and Description |
|---|
QDR.QDRMapEntry(java.lang.String key, java.lang.Object value) |
public QDR.QDRMapEntry(java.lang.String key,
java.lang.Object value)
public java.lang.String getKey()
getKey in interface java.util.Map.Entrypublic java.lang.Object getValue()
getValue in interface java.util.Map.Entrypublic java.lang.Object setValue(java.lang.Object value)
setValue in interface java.util.Map.Entrypublic boolean equals(java.lang.Object o)
equals in interface java.util.Map.Entryequals in class java.lang.Objectpublic int hashCode()
(e.getKey()==null ? 0 : e.getKey().hashCode()) ^
(e.getValue()==null ? 0 : e.getValue().hashCode())
This ensures that e1.equals(e2) implies that e1.hashCode()==e2.hashCode() for any two Entries e1 and e2, as required by the general contract of Object.hashCode.hashCode in interface java.util.Map.EntryhashCode in class java.lang.ObjectObject.hashCode(), Object.equals(Object), equals(Object)